Creating SPF, DMARC, and DKIM Records
Many email service providers such as Google and Yahoo are requiring that companies that send automated emails set up DMARC and SPF records for their domains to prevent email delivery issues after February 2024.
If you are using an email marketing or newsletter service such as Hubspot, Mailchimp, Zoho, Constant Contact, etc. you may have received an email asking that you add their service to your SPF record and that you create a DMARC or DKIM record for your domain. What is a DMARC record?
A DMARC record is a DNS TXT record that tells your email recipient's email service what to do with messages that don't match or authenticate with your SPF or DKIM records. The DMARC record also allows you to specify an email address where you may receive reports about email messages sent from your domain that aren't authenticating.
What is an SPF record?
An SPF record an DNS TXT record used for email sender authentication. Your domain's SPF record will include a list of IP addresses and services that are authorized to send emails on behalf of your domain. If you use a service to send marketing or newsletter emails then that service will need to be listed in your SPF record. Note that your domain should only have one SPF record.
What is a DKIM record?
A DKIM record is a DNS TXT record that stores an encryption key that is used to verify an email's message signature. If an email marketing or newsletter service requires you to set up a DKIM record they will provide the encryption key needed for the record.
